Industry Overview

Plant Growing Medium refers to the substrate material that supports plant growth by providing nutrients, aeration, and moisture retention. These media can be organic or inorganic and are used in various cultivation methods like soil-based, hydroponic, and container gardening. The medium directly influences plant health and productivity, with common types including peat moss, coco coir, and rockwool. Choosing the right growing medium is essential for sustainable agriculture and horticulture practices, affecting crop yield and quality.
The Plant Growing Medium market is experiencing robust growth, projected to achieve a compound annual growth rate CAGR of 9.50% during the forecast period. Valued at 3.6Billion, the market is expected to reach 6.5Billion by 2032, with a year-on-year growth rate of 10.00%

Market Entropy
  • In February 2025, EcoGrow Solutions and TerraSoil introduced biochar and microbe-enriched growing media for urban and vertical farming. Demand rose globally, particularly in Europe and North America, focusing on peat-free, biodegradable solutions improving water retention and nutrient delivery. Climate-resilient agriculture and organic certifications drove adoption.

Regulatory Landscape
  • Regulations enforce ingredient safety, biodegradability, and contaminant control in growing media. Organic certification requirements and water retention efficacy standards are monitored. Authorities also regulate potential leaching of chemicals to protect soil and groundwater.
